About this combination

Combination 259 of 348 in Wada's six-volume 1933 work. A 4-colour grouping of Lemon Yellow, Green Blue, Helvetia Blue, Warm Gray, as documented in the original plates.

Historical context

Plate 259 of Wada's 348 anchors Lemon Yellow, Green Blue, Helvetia Blue and Warm Gray in the yellow family — a 4-colour grouping with a refined, cool, bold character, recorded in the Showa-era volumes of Sanzo Wada's 1933 Dictionary of Color Combinations, where these shikisai names have sat in the public domain for generations. Its strongest pairing — Lemon Yellow on Helvetia Blue — reaches a contrast ratio of 5.97:1, meeting the WCAG AA bar for body text, so it holds up for text-on-colour layouts as well as decorative use.
